Transaction ebc8fcb43ea73f5ee25fa13848d0fad73ab5aed01d53a2ab0daca1418879f300
1 Input
1 Output
-
ebc8fcb43ea73f5ee25fa13848d0fad73ab5aed01d53a2ab0daca1418879f300:0
- value
- 26686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3fd72e6114fc38899a334ba85b626123c6aed88 OP_EQUAL
- address
- MW9G3yg1G6srA21QzH6Nm4Ep5XFvSGNiEN